Specifications

  • Model: P51-15-S-Z-I36-4.5V-000-000
  • Pressure Range: 0-15 psi
  • Output: 4.5V
  • Accuracy: ±0.5%
  • Operating Temperature: -40°C to 125°C
  • Supply Voltage: 5VDC
  • Electrical Connection: Integral cable or connector

Detailed Pin Configuration

The detailed pin configuration of the P51-15-S-Z-I36-4.5V-000-000 sensor includes: 1. Vcc (Power supply) 2. GND (Ground) 3. Output

Working Principles

The P51-15-S-Z-I36-4.5V-000-000 operates on the principle of piezoresistive sensing, where changes in pressure cause a corresponding change in electrical resistance, which is then converted into an output voltage proportional to the applied pressure.
